1. Remove the stab plan from your building board, and

lay out the fuselage plan. Cover the fin area of the plan with
Great Planes Plans Protector so the glue won’t stick to
the plan.

2. See the Expert Tip that follows, then use thin CA to

edge glue the two leftover pieces of 4" wide sheeting from
the stabilizer. Cut off the excess sheeting as shown in the
photo. Cut the sheeting diagonally to create two fin sheets.

HOW TO JOIN SHEETING

A. Use a metal straightedge as a guide to trim one edge
of both sheets.

B. Use masking tape to tightly tape the two sheets
together joining the trimmed edges.

C. Turn the sheet over and place weights on top of the
sheet to hold it. Apply thin CA sparingly to the seam
between the two places, quickly wiping away excess CA
with a paper towel as you proceed.

D. Turn the sheet over and remove the masking tape,
then apply thin CA to the seam the same way you did for
the other side.

E. Sand the sheet flat and smooth with your bar sander
and 150-grit sandpaper.
